Output 309a75b847acce322ff0c810d34683a97985e4ff2f62d4d43f8f235571e4d2b6:1

value
26148326
script pubkey
OP_0 OP_PUSHBYTES_20 5e7b6dbe0e58b7fe42550e46e938c9a98ecc0bb6
address
bc1qteakm0swtzmlusj4perwjwxf4x8vczak8wms5y
transaction
309a75b847acce322ff0c810d34683a97985e4ff2f62d4d43f8f235571e4d2b6
spent
true